Dead Key Fob Battery

One of the most frequent reasons for the slow response of a key fob is that the battery has died. If you find that you need to press the unlock button multiple times before your car keys repairs responds, or it's not able to lock from far away as it used to it's likely time to get a new battery. It's simple to replace the battery on the key fob.

Press the unlock button a few times to verify that the fob is working. If you're certain that it isn't due to being out of range, you can try a few things to help bring it back to life. First, ensure you have the fob with you. If there is enough power in the battery, you can activate it by pressing it against the door handle.

The battery type will be printed on the key fob. It's usually a battery called the button cell. Brands such as Duracell or Energizer sell them. Once you have the right battery, you can remove the old one and replace it with the new one. Make sure the positive side is facing up. Join the fob halves and test the lock/unlock/start functions.

If you would like to be extra secure, you can bring the fob along to a repair shop for watches or to your car dealer and ask them to replace its battery for you. It's likely to cost a little more than if you did it yourself however it's a good idea get someone else to do it to ensure you don't end up damaging the circuit board while you're trying to open the fob to change the battery.

If you'd rather save the money, you can buy a CR2032 battery at an online hardware store or big box retailer, and follow the steps in your owner's manual (which is likely accessible online as PDFs on the website of the manufacturer or at a minimum on YouTube) to replace the fob's battery yourself. It's a simple procedure and will restore the useful functions of the remote you use so often on your journeys around Springfield.

Circuitry Problems

Your key fob experiences many abuses and stress while you use it. This is because it is dropped, tossed and exposed to cold and hot on a daily basis. This can cause damage to internal components, including the tiny electronic circuitry that transmits signals to the car. Depending on how badly damaged these signals are, they may stop working and stop you from opening your doors or even starting your car.

If you've tried replacing the battery but it doesn't work the fob might require reprogramming specifically for your particular model and make. This can be accomplished by a dealer, or a professional shop that has expertise in your vehicle. It is a straightforward procedure that takes just few minutes to complete.

The casing of your fob may also be worn out and lose contact with internal components. The casing contains contacts, which are rubber-like components coated in electricity-conducting film that assist with sending the signal to your broken car key repair near me. They can wear out over time, or snap completely. A replacement casing is a straightforward fix that will bring your device back to its original functionality.

Sometimes, your key fob only has to be changed to reflect the current year, model, and make of your vehicle. This is a simple solution that you can do at home or with an expert if you own an extra fob. The process is usually quite simple and involves only following a few steps from your manufacturer's website or your local dealership's service center.

It is possible that your key fob has to be replaced entirely however this is usually more expensive and may require a visit to the dealer or an independent shop with experience in your specific make and model. Replacing a key fob generally the best option when it isn't working correctly and you do not want to risk being stranded somewhere. Based on the manufacturer and model, replacements can vary in cost from $50 to $150 or more.
